Why We Lose Touch with Ourselves

From a young age, we’re subtly (or maybe not-so-subtly) taught to conform. Society, culture, family, and even well-meaning friends often impose ideas about what’s “right” or “successful.” Over time, these messages are absorbed and we start shaping our lives around them, rather than around what genuinely fulfills us.

This disconnection is often at the root of stress and anxiety. When we live our lives based on others expectations instead of what we truly want, it creates a tension between who we are and who we’re pretending to be. Eventually, we might wake up one day feeling joyless, unmotivated, or even anxious—because we’ve lost touch with our authentic selves.

Signs You’ve Lost Connection with What Truly Brings You Joy

Are you wondering if you’ve strayed from your true self? Here are some common signs:

- You’re constantly tired or unmotivated, even when you’re meeting life’s “requirements.”

- You find yourself doing things because you “should”, not because you really want to.

- Your passions feel distant or irrelevant. Things that used to excite you now feel like a waste of time or pointless.  

- You struggle with anxiety or a lingering sense of unease, as if you’re always waiting for something to go wrong.

If any of these strike a chord, it might be time to stop and think about whether you’re living life in your terms or are you just following a script that’s been handed to you.

How to Reconnect with Your Authentic Self

Reconnecting involves peeling back layers of conditioning and rediscovering what truly matters to you. Here are a few ways to start:

- Journal with Intention: Reflect on moments when you felt most alive or at peace. What were you doing? Who were you with? How did it feel?  I never used to do this, I thought it was pointless, but now I have a 5 year diary and I love writing a wee paragraph about my day, and also reading what’s happened in years past.   

- Revisit Childhood Joys: What brought you joy as a child? Often, the activities we loved before external expectations took hold can offer clues to what really makes us tick.

- Practice Mindfulness: Being present can help you tune into your true desires. What thoughts or activities naturally make you feel like you, rather than constricted?
